Big Cat Country Q&A: Should we be concerned about Leonard Fournette?

New York Jets v Jacksonville Jaguars Photo by Don Juan Moore/Getty Images

Let’s answer some Jacksonville Jaguars questions after yesterday’s Week 8 win over the New York Jets!

Chris from Fernandina Beach, FL

Q: How concerned should we be that if you take away Leonard Fournette’s 66 yard run he had 18 carries for 10 yards?

A: Concerned? Fournette complained of a stomach virus after the game and he said his sprint on the opening drive just threw him for a loop for the rest of the game. Despite that, he carried the load on the ground, added seven catches for 60 yards, and was excellent in pass protection. In franchise history, no running back has gotten to 1,000 yards from scrimmage in 8 games. He did it yesterday. In franchise history, no running back has gotten to 3,000 yards from scrimmage before their 30th career game. He did it yesterday. He’s having a Pro Bowl season that can turn into an All-Pro season if things break right his way. Be encouraged — Fournette is turning into a very good running back.

David from Frisco, TX

Q: Does Gardner Minshew’s performance next week against the Houston Texans (and specifically if we win or lose) determine if he’s benched or not?

A: Yes and no. If he has an awful game (like what he had against the New Orleans Saints) it would fuel the fire for Nick Foles to come back in. But personally, it would be a mistake to bench Minshew. He’s setting all time NFL records for rookie quarterbacks. He’s 4-3 as a starter with a team that just traded away its most talented player. The locker room loves him. The fans love him. He’s winning games. I think anything other than “Minshew is our guy unless he’s injured” would be a mistake.
